142,595 is a composite number, odd.
142,595 (one hundred forty-two thousand five hundred ninety-five) is an odd 6-digit number. It is a composite number with 12 divisors, and factors as 5 × 19² × 79. Written other ways, in hexadecimal, 0x22D03.
